Durso, Rosina, Age: 93, Red Bank

703

Rosina Durso, 93, of Red Bank, passed away peacefully May 28. She was born in Montano Antilia, Italy to the late Montano and Antonetta (Portolese) Scaniello. Rosina was an excellent cook who loved spending time with her family and friends. She enjoyed knitting blankets for Birthright and area hospitals.

She is predeceased by her husband, Anthony, in 2000, and her two sisters, Maria and Josephine. She is survived by her three loving sons, Lawrence Durso and wife Patricia; Montano Durso and wife Rosa; and John Durso and wife Cynthia; her six cherished grandchildren, Michael and wife Kelly, Joseph, Jennifer, Thomas, Steven and Courtney; her great-grandson Dylan; her dear sister Paulina; and her loving caregiver Olga.

Visitation was held at the John E. Day Funeral Home, Red Bank, May 30. A Mass of Christian Burial was celebrated at St. Leo’s RC Church Thursday, May 31. Entombment followed at Fair View Mausoleum in Middletown.
